Sizes
For a life-size standard model, the most popular size, is about 1.8-1.9 meters tall, the average height of an adult male. This size perfectly matches the image of Superman as he is depicted in film, television, and comics. This size makes people feel like they are really standing in front of Superman.
The scaled-down, adaptable model is adjusted according to the exhibition area, generally about 1.2-1.5 meters in height. This is the best size for relatively small space display, such as in living rooms, small studies, boutiques, and so on.
Giant display model is even bigger, over 2.5-3 meters in height. Giant statues of this size are very eye-catching and are often placed in open-air plazas, theme park entrances, or other open spaces. They can be seen from a distance and attract the attention of visitors, and even increase the popularity of the site.

Budget
Basic statues in the $1,000 to $5,000 price range are quite affordable. They use “stock” or standard designs, basic craftsmanship and pose effects, are lacking in special effects or custom work, and are intended to satisfy the general public’s demand for a Superman statue.
Statues from $5,000 to $12,000 are in the mid- to high-end range, use more precise craftsmanship and detailing, and may include special effects, like a cape made from a more expensive material with greater drape and gloss.
Budget for a custom statue will vary widely depending on the level of complexity requested, generally from $5,000 to +$10000. Unique poses, special suit patterns, or complex set props will add to the cost of production.
